Transaction feba5f06a7eebf2bfdc39b2f90fe7bd4804577357ea6d7bff7a441c85056d23e
1 Input
1 Output
-
feba5f06a7eebf2bfdc39b2f90fe7bd4804577357ea6d7bff7a441c85056d23e:0
- value
- 128308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bd0135919afc1c5c58cc263dcad2375192c9460 OP_EQUAL
- address
- 3QeUo39VhG57nGwgRx54BE1fkskdQ53iK7